Venture Builders vs. Startup Studios : Defining the Gap
While both used as replacements for one another, company creation hubs and emerging factories represent unique approaches to creating companies. A venture builder typically concentrates on identifying voids and then forming a group to implement a strategy, often with proprietary resources and a collection of ventures . Differently, emerging studios often possess a more methodical process , deploying a reusable framework and staff to quickly prototype several businesses concurrently. The key rests in the extent of ownership and the scope of the initiative – company creation hubs tend to be more adaptable , while startup factories prioritize efficiency through consistency .

Startup Studios: Accelerating Innovation & De-Risking Venture Creation
The emergence of startup studios represents a fresh approach to driving new ideas and reducing the uncertainties inherent in building companies. Unlike traditional seed programs, these firms proactively build multiple businesses simultaneously, leveraging a pooled resource base and skillset. This system allows for rapid prototyping, preliminary validation of product-market fit , and a considerable reduction in the aggregate risk associated with founding new businesses. They typically have focused teams. They frequently use a consistent process. Success rates are generally higher.

Beyond Incubators: How Business Builders are Creating New Industries
While commonplace incubators continue to fulfill a vital purpose in nurturing early-stage startups, a new breed of organization – company builders – are increasingly redefining how entire industries develop. These builders don't simply offer mentorship and capital ; they actively identify market gaps, build minimum viable products , and attract teams to initiate various companies from the ground up . This novel approach, often investing significant proprietary resources, is leading to the creation of entirely new ecosystems within areas including fintech, eco-friendly technology, and cutting-edge healthcare, demonstrating a significant shift in the innovation landscape.
